Gujar Khedi
Gujar Khedi is a village located in Raghogarh tehsil of Guna district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 14km away from sub-district headquarter Raghogarh. Guna is the district headquarter of Gujar Khedi village. As per 2009 stats, Narayanpura is the gram panchayat of Gujar Khedi village.

About Gujar Khedi
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Gujar Khedi is 499287. The village spans a total geographical area of 195.8 hectares. Raghogarh is nearest town to Gujar Khedi village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 14km away.
When it comes to local governance, Gujar Khedi village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Raghogarh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Rajgarh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Gujar Khedi
Below is a concise population overview of Gujar Khedi as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 198 | 110 | 88 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 39 | 19 | 20 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 11 | 7 | 4 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 22 | 12 | 10 |
Literate Population | 110 | 76 | 34 |
Illiterate Population | 88 | 34 | 54 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Gujar Khedi village:
- The total population of Gujar Khedi village is around 198, including approximately 110 males and 88 females, with a sex ratio of 800 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 39 children aged 0–6 years in Gujar Khedi village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Gujar Khedi village has 11 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 22 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Gujar Khedi village is about 55.56%, with male literacy at 69.09% and female literacy at 38.64%.
- There are around 38 households in Gujar Khedi village.
Connectivity of Gujar Khedi
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Gujar Khedi. As per the 2011 stats, Gujar Khedi had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
